Jean-Paul Brun, the owner, farmer, and winemaker at Domaine des Terres Dorees, is a hero of ours and to many other wine lovers all over the world. His estate is located just north of Lyon, in the southern part of Beaujolais, and all of the farming is done without the use of chemicals, aka organically.

In the early 1990’s, Brun planted several hectares of Chardonnay on limestone soil, the same type of “dirt” that produces some of the greatest Chardonnays in the world. As demand for his Chardonnay increased, he expanded his holdings and began contracting for grapes with other local organic vignerons with limestone soils.

These days, this wine is composed of grapes from vineyards that range in age from 22 to 80 years of age. You can definitely smell and taste the old-vine character of this wine, and that’s what makes it such an incredible value. The wine is fermented entirely in stainless steel, but trust us you won’t miss the oak on this one because it’s quite rich, layered and textured.

The nose is classic French Chardonnay in the form of pure apple, pear and lemon with some apricot and honeydew sneaking in there too. And mineral, oh yeah, this one’s got some serious mineral that comes through in the wine smelling like wet rock and oyster shell. This might sound gross to some of you, but trust us, it’s aromas like these that people pay hundreds of dollars for and it’s quite subtle.

On the palate, this one has great weight, texture and balance with a nice mix of round orchard fruits balanced by tangy and tart citrus, finishing with a complex mix of white flowers, gentle spice, and mineral.
